    Quote Originally Posted by Daveindiego View Post
    I can control my entire iTunes library through my iPhone using Remote. It's all hooked up to my Stereo/TV via the AppleTV, which is a tiny box a little bit bigger than a hockey puck that sits behind my TV. I've been doing it for a couple years now. I love it.
    Dave on point as usual.

    you need to use a free program called handbrake that will convert your DVDs to allow them to be in the iTunes library.

    Takes about 15-30 min per disc.

    Quote Originally Posted by fenderbaum View Post
    We have a winner, I think?

    That is exactly what I was looking for that I never knew existed. Thank you so much.
    You're welcome. I have one of these (an older model) and it plays everything. It doesn't matter what I throw at it. MKV, AVI, MPEG, DVD & Blu-ray ISO's... it eats it all. Put a big HDD in there and you're good to go.

    Or if you really wanna go hard-core, get one of these:
    http://www.synology.com/products/pro...S413j&lang=enu

    and put 4 big HDD's in there. You can have over 10TB of storage that way. Hook both machines up to your home network and you're good to go.
